    if you read my original quote, I was asking the question:

    "but is it a known issue with TrailBlazers as well?"
    ...and if you read the V1 manual (this is cut-and-pasted verbatim):

    Laser False Alarms

    1. Red neon, from stores and occasionally from brake
    lights of other cars (example: Chevy TrailBlazer,
    GMC Envoy, Olds Bravada and Buick Rainier), can
    imitate the characteristics of speed laser.
    Solution: Move away from source.

    2. The electrical systems of some cars generate
    electromagnetic interferences, triggering laser alerts.
    How to test: Try V1 in a different car.
    Possible solution: Try relocating detector within the
    interfering car; also, your dealer may have a factory fix.

    3. Adaptive cruise control systems using laser may cause
    laser alerts.
    Solution: Switch to normal cruise control.

    Doesn't get much more known than that.
